Riparian Buffers Best Management Practices: Tree Revetments
Pub Number: MF2750
Description: Tree revetments are cut trees anchored at the bottom
of unstable streambanks. These trees slow current along the bank, decreasing erosion. Eastern redcedar is usually best.
